1. Coral Bay

Coral Bay is best sandy beach in Cyprus, which is located in the city of Paphos. It is located in a small quiet bay and is surrounded by high mountains: on one side you can see the cape, and on the other stretches the Maa-Paleokastro peninsula. Thanks to this location, there is almost no strong wind on the beach, and the sea is several degrees warmer than in the central areas.

The shore of Coral Bay Beach is covered with fine and soft yellowish sand. Unlike many other beaches, the sand here does not contain pebbles or shells, which is appreciated by families with children. The surface of the beach is smooth and soft, and the descent into the water is gentle.

The beach is equipped with everything necessary: ​​changing rooms, showers, fountains for washing feet. Lifeguards are constantly on duty on the shore. There are also cafes and restaurants. There are inflatable slides and a banana boat for children, while adults can rent water equipment.

The Mycenaean Colonization Museum and a small working archaeological site are located nearby.

2. Lara

Lara Beach is located in a cozy bay of the Akamas Peninsula near Paphos. It is also called Turtle Beach: for many years, sea turtles crawl ashore to lay their eggs. The Cypriot authorities especially carefully protect this area, and it is classified as a protected area. You won’t be able to relax here with umbrellas or sun loungers: there may be turtle nests with eggs in the sand.

You can get to this wild and picturesque beach on foot or in a small SUV. There is no special road to the shore to avoid large influxes of tourists. And although sunbathing on this beach is not very convenient, many travelers come here to enjoy the beauty of the unique nature and swim in the clearest water: at the depths you can see sea turtles and other sea inhabitants. On the outskirts of the beach, it is recommended to visit a special house of scientists, where you can see photographs and study the breeding process of turtles.

3. Aya Thekla

This beautiful beach of the island of Cyprus is located in Ayia Napa and is known to many vacationers due to the proximity of the blue and white chapel of St. Thekla. It will be appreciated by tourists who love freedom of space and avoid large crowds of people. Compared to the central beaches, Agia Thekla can be called a rather secluded corner.

The shore of this beautiful Cyprus beach is covered with light and soft sand and is suitable for family holidays. It is worth considering that in the depths of the water the bottom is quite rocky: it is better to wear special shoes. Not far from the shore in the sea there is a small island where it will be convenient to sunbathe. You can wade your way to it, but beyond the end of the island the sea ends in shallow water.

On the shore, umbrellas and sun loungers can be rented, there are sanitary areas with changing rooms, and small cafes. For lovers of active recreation there is a volleyball court. On specially designated days of the week, various fairs are held on the beach.

4. Fig Tree Bay Beach

Fig Tree Bay Beach is the best beach in Protaras. It is also the most visited beach in Cyprus, not only among guests of the island, but also among local residents. It got its name from a fig grove located a little to the side. According to legend, on the site of the coastal zone, a large fig tree grew for many centuries, which was cut down to improve this corner.

The beach itself is located in a bay with surprisingly clear water: the open path into the sea is covered by a large stone island. Thanks to him, the sea near the shore is always calm, without large waves.

The beach is as comfortable as possible: cafes and restaurants, sun loungers for rent, a sanitary area with showers and changing rooms. There are inflatable slides for children and youth, and there is also a volleyball court. Main advantages: unusually light and fine sand and shallow waters.

In the northern part of the beach, diving enthusiasts can explore underwater rock caves.

6. Konnos Bay

Konnos Bay is located in a quiet bay near Protaras, and is part of the Cavo Greko National Park. This picturesque beach of Cyprus is reliably protected from the winds by hills, and the sea water in this place is unusually clear.

The sand of Konnos Bay beach is distinguished by a grayish tint, which it acquired from an admixture of volcanic sand. The descent into the water in the central part is smooth and sandy, and on the left side there are underwater rocks and rocks: diving enthusiasts can explore marine life.

Above the beach along the entire hill there are small observation platforms with benches. You can take great photos from the heights of the mountains. There are also summer cafes with picturesque views of the sea.

The beach itself is fully equipped: showers, changing rooms, sun loungers, etc. Those interested can go skiing, scootering, or book a boat trip to explore the entire protected area.

7. Pissouri

Pissouri occupies a special place on the list of the best beaches in Cyprus. The beach is secluded in a bay and adjacent to a small picturesque village with the same name. This place is never crowded: it will take a long time to get to the shore from a road or a densely populated area. But this is where you can feel all the charm of wild nature and take a break from the bustle of the city. Mostly local residents and guests of neighboring respectable hotels sunbathe here.

The beach shore is always well-groomed and clean, but lying on the sand will not be very comfortable: the grayish sand here is mixed with stones of different sizes. Boulders and pebbles are also found on the seabed: it is better to take special shoes for swimming. The descent into the water quickly gains depth, so swimming with children on this beach is not recommended, although there are practically no big waves.

For the convenience of vacationers, there are still umbrellas and sun loungers on the shore, and you can have a snack in a tavern or cafe located above the beach. Tourists come to this quiet corner to enjoy the silence and photograph the unforgettable landscapes of the cliffs of the Mediterranean Sea.

9. Ladies' Mile

The longest beach, Ladies' Mile, is located on the Akrotiri peninsula. It stretches for almost 8 km and has both a pebble surface and coastal stripes with sand. An embankment with all kinds of cafes and shops stretches along the entire coastline; not far from the shore you can find an orange grove.

It is noteworthy that this beach has both equipped areas and wild places for secluded relaxation. From the north, starting from the port, the beach line is covered with stones, and the descent into the water has a large slope. On the south side the beaches are sandy, with gentle slopes. Families with children choose places in shallow water: the depth begins almost 10 meters from the shore. Windsurfers also like these places: further from the coast, the open sea has strong currents and pampers with big waves.

All equipped areas for vacationers have sanitary areas with showers and changing rooms. Near the water you can find water attractions and slides.

Stone of Aphrodite (Petra tou Romiou)


The beach near the rock Aphrodite's Stone boasts clear water and surrounding rocks.

The beach itself consists of pebbles and sea stones, which gives it an unusual color - a mixture of orange, pink and red. Some believe that Aphrodite's stone is a distant rock, others believe that it is a dark stone that stands approximately in the middle of the beach.


The beach is located between Paphos and Limassol. You can find it easily if you pay attention to the signs that say "Petra-tu-Romiu". On the way to the beach there will be beautiful views of nature and the coast.

To get there, you need to stop either by the road or find one nearby parking. You will reach the beach through underground passage under the road.

Nissi Beach / Nissi Bay


Nissi Beach is perhaps the most important attraction of the entire resort town. During the day you can relax on pure white sand and swim in crystal clear water, and in the evening have a nice time in bars, where they often host various competitions for adults.


The name of the beach comes from a small island, which is connected to the shore by a rather narrow sandy isthmus. This island is called ΝΗΣΙ (read as "nisi") and is translated from Greek as "island". During high tides it can be completely submerged.

After sunset, the sandy beach turns into outdoor dance floor. Foam parties are held here.


There is also entertainment for children here. To begin with, it is worth mentioning that the beach is very comfortable and gentle entry into the sea, fine sand and very clear water. Also on the beach there are scooters, motor boats with "bananas", everything for a beach volleyball And football, and many other entertainments.

The fewest tourists relax in the morning on the left side of the beach, but by noon you can forget about privacy. Extreme sportsmen can jump off a cliff into the water.

If it is important for you to relax in silence, then you can move to a quieter place, for example, Makronissos.

Lara Beach


This beach is one of the most secluded and deserted on the entire coast of the Akamas Peninsula.

The hidden Lara Beach can be reached either independently or as part of an Akamas tour. There is a lot of greenery and the views are incredible. beautiful panoramic views to the western part of the island.


If you decide to come on your own, it is better to do so on an SUV, as you will have to overcome dirt roads and rocky terrain, and stones and hard tree branches can scratch your car.


It is worth noting that Lara is one of the rare places in the Mediterranean where people swim in the summer rare sea turtles(Green and Hawksbill turtle) to lay eggs.
